Karey is an avid cyclist and adventurer and has been so most of her life. While she has taken intermittent breaks from epic adventures because of her schooling and life in general, the great outdoors always seems to beckon her to return. She has made a name for herself in the local bike racing scene where she founded an all women's bike racing team, West Coast Women's Cycling and was acting director until 2018. She also previously served as the women's racing liaison for the Oregon Bicycle Racing Association from 2013 - 2016 and is still an advocate for all things women's cycling and adventuring! Karey has also been involved in a grassroot community organization here in Arizona called  Hawes Babes Ride On (HBRO) and has been helping lady riders find groups to ride with and develop their skills, and pours herself into other riders.
